Common Stock and Florida Blue Family

Plant family is the group of plants which have something in common. Common Stock and Florida Blue family is a major factor of Common Stock and Florida Blue Scientific Classification. Plant family helps you narrow the search of your plants. It also gives you idea about, how the plant looks, how the seed will be like etc. These two plant families can be different or same. Common Stock belongs to the family Brassicaceae and Florida Blue belongs to the family Gentianaceae.

Common Stock and Florida Blue Genus and Other Classification

While comparing scientific classification, Common Stock and Florida Blue genus and other classification are also important. Also, when you compare Common Stock and Florida Blue,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Matthiola and other plant's genus is Eustoma. Common Stock tribe is Not Available and Florida Blue tribe is Chironieae. Common Stock cl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Capparales whereas Florida Blue clade is Angiosperms, Asterids and Eudicots and order is Gentianales. Every plant have subfamilies.
